Best Rated Robot Vacuum CleanerRobot vacuums are great for keeping your floors tidy however they aren't a replacement for the regular vacuum. Even the most powerful robots have trouble getting deep into rugs and carpets, and they can get tangled in cords and socks.
Staying on top of routine maintenance (replacing filters, cutting tangled hair from brushes, and emptying the dust bin) can help your robot last longer.
Battery Life
Most robot vacuums can handle a few cleaning sessions before requiring a charge. The runner-up in our overall picks is the Ecovacs Deebot Q30S Combo, has a battery capable of lasting up to 180 minutes (3,230 square feet) of cleaning time on one charge. That amount of runtime is enough to clean the majority of smaller homes that have carpets that are hard and low-pile carpets, or a larger home where the rooms are roughly the same size.
A longer battery lifespan also means that the best robot vacuum cleaner robot will spend more time cleaning and less charging its dock. It's recommended to select models that have a self-emptying dust bin because these models are more efficient when it comes to cleaning up debris and returning to the dock to recharge. It is important to clean or replace filters and wipe down sensors and camera regularly so that they can see clearly.
Smart mapping technology is an important feature to look out for because it allows you to program your robot to clean certain rooms or avoid areas where it's more likely to crash into furniture or other obstacles. It's also useful for ensuring that your robot is able to go under and around beds, sofas and other furniture that is tall. Some cheap robovacs come with boundary strips you can use to block certain areas. Other models of higher quality rely on sensors and cameras.
Even the best robot vacs aren't able to replace a traditional vacuum for heavy-duty large-pile dirt and other debris. It's wise to keep a traditional power vac in reserve to handle these chores and to schedule robot vacs regularly for cleaning up light chores throughout the week.
Navigation
A robot should be capable of navigating your home without getting caught or running into objects like metal screws or pet hair, or sand. In our tests, we employ a tracking device to track the robot as it goes through a multiroom lab and shows its surroundings. We also check how well the robot can avoid obstacles such as power cords, furniture legs and pet waste.
The best robots are able to identify multiple floors and recognize landmarks like doors and windows. The most advanced robots such as the Roborock S8 Pro Ultra have a dual sensor navigation system, which uses a LIDAR to create a floor plan and a structured-light camera at the front to identify objects in real-time. This lets the S8 to stay clear of common obstacles like power cords and furniture legs and can also store up to four floor maps within its internal memory.
Cheaper models don't come with this type of object detection and rely on bump sensors, which aren't as accurate. Apps
Robot vacuums are similar to their upright counterparts and require an array of technologies to keep them up to date. The result is a pretty mature market full of options. Even the top models require interaction from their users, especially when it comes to plan cleaning schedules, design the automatic floor cleaner plan of your home and set up virtual barriers.
To help reduce this kind of interaction, look for a model that has its own app to recognize the layout of your home and save these settings for the future. This will let the vacuum start where it left off on subsequent runs, without having to restart the mapping process each time.
It is also recommended to look for models that provide spot or zone cleaning. These allow you to tell the robot vacuum to concentrate on a specific spot like under the dining room table after an enormous family meal. You can typically do this via the app or voice commands.
Many models also provide object avoidance. It permits the robot, when it comes across objects in its path, like a box of shoes or a crate containing dog toys, to guide itself around. This will prevent it from crashing into objects that could harm its sensors or cause jams.

Pet Hair
Choose an upright vacuum cleaner specifically designed to collect pet hair. The most effective models will have the highest suction, a brush which keeps hair from tangling and an automated emptying mechanism. Some models are able to detect dirt levels to adjust the intensity of cleaning. They are able to detect objects that aren't a part of your home's flooring like furniture toys, food bowls, toys, cords, and more.
Some robot vacuums come with additional features that are pet-friendly. These include a water dispenser which is used to mop floors and an HEPA filtering system that eliminates allergens, such as pet dust. They may also have an operation that is quieter to cut down on the amount of noise generated during cleaning sessions.
Robot vacuums with mapping capabilities are a great option for pet owners. They're designed to assess your home and devise an attack plan based on the layout of each room as well as obstacles. For example the Shark Matrix Plus 2-in-1 Robot Vacuum is a smart automatic vacuum cleaner that has an impressive ability to map the room and navigate around furniture and other obstacles using accelerometer and gyroscope smart sensors that work together to learn the layout of your room.
Other advanced models let you define no-go zones that are areas that the robot is supposed to avoid--like fragile items or pet feeding spots--by adjusting settings using an app. This feature is particularly useful for busy households, as you can schedule cleaning sessions without having to be in the room where the vacuum is. Another feature that is extremely useful is spot cleaning that allows you to direct the vacuum to clean a specific area that may be particularly filthy or full of pet hair.
